| ADVANCED bows and daggerboards |
 |
The H42 is unlike any other production
daggerboard
catamaran on the market. Advanced high aspect ratio
daggerboards are inclined to provide positive lift at high
speed, effectively reducing resistance and wetted
surface. In addition the twin performance foils create
hydrodinamic lift to windward and thus optimize upwind
VMG.
The high tech bows, revolutionized by the hull shape of
Formula 1 tris, allow a reduction in weight and windage,
yet provide important reserve buoyancy when pressing
the boat in gale conditions.
The fine shape of the stem at the waterline allows for
excellent light air characteristics, by minimizing wave
making and parasitic hull drag. A flared section further
up provides the all important volume needed to prevent
nose digging. At deck level the stem radius tapers back
to form a very rigid attachment for the crossbeam and
also to reduce aero and hydrodinamic drag.
Also new, is the material of the stems. A black
extremely resilient elastomer acts as built in bumper
and will reduce hull damage in case of frontal impacts.
Not only does it give the boat a high tech look but is a
practical safety feature found in no other catamaran.

| Ultimate SAFETY and DESIGN |
 |
The H42 provides ultimate safety features of positive
flotation, watertight bulkheads and integrated crash
zones, which art isolated from the living accomodations
of the vessel. Strict standards of the EC provide
her with a " Category 1A offshore" homologation.
The triple crash boxes - the forward one even filled
with foam - and the innovative bow protection system
will also
reduce damage in case of collisions. ,br>Every effort
was
made by reknown designer (B. Lelievre of C-Class Little
Americas Cup fame) to center weights. All
accomodations are between the center and aft beams
reserving the extremeties of the H42 for watertight
bulkheads and storage.

| High Tech Construction |
 |
The composite hulls and the nacelle consist of a PVC
foam sandwich and are entirely vacuum bagged.
Bulkheads and interior fittings are constructed with
honeycomb and PVC sandwich panels and are also
vacuum bagged for an optimal strength to weight ratio.
The entire boat is constructed using high grade
isophthalic
vinylester resins. The separate crossbeams are built
using a monolithic laminating process for ultimate
resilience and reliability. Vacuum bagged foam core is
also used for decks and cockpit floors to provide
stiffness, strength and minimum weight. Daggerboard
and trunks built in a
high strength vinylester composite compound. A skeg is
integrated into the bottom of the hull to protect
saildrive and rudder from beaching and impacts.
Helios 42 is available in two anti-leeway
versions: either with dagger-boards or with keels.
The all composite H42 comes with a 5 year structural
and 3 year osmosis warranty.
